Joaquín Bondoni Gress (born May 8, 2003) is a Mexican actor and singer known for playing the role of Cuauhtémoc "Temo" López in the Soap operas Mi marido tiene más familia (2018) and Juntos el corazón nunca se equivoca (2019).
He trained as an actor at the Centro de Educación Artística, in Mexico City. He made his debut in 2010 participating in television productions such as La Rosa de Guadalupe, Como dice el dicho, Ni contigo ni sin ti, and La Piloto. He was part of the musical group Tres 8 Uno in 2018.
He has also participated in theater plays such as Una tarde cualquiera (2016), Aristemo el musical (2019), Distorsión (2020) and Todo el mundo habla de Jamie (2023)
His film debut was in the short film Cobalto (2023) directed by Julián Hernández.
